All errors (new ones prefixed by >>):
kernel/sched/fair.c: In function 'pick_next_task_fair':
kernel/sched/fair.c:7034:6: error: implicit declaration of function 'sched_idle_cpu'; did you mean 'sched_idle_rq'? [-Werror=implicit-function-declaration]
7034 | sched_idle_cpu(rq->cpu))
| 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~
| sched_idle_rq
>> kernel/sched/fair.c:7034:23: error: 'struct rq' has no member named 'cpu'
7034 | sched_idle_cpu(rq->cpu))
| ^~
cc1: some warnings being treated as errors
vim +7034 kernel/sched/fair.c
7023
7024 struct task_struct *
7025 pick_next_task_fair(struct rq *rq, struct task_struct *prev, struct rq_flags *rf)
7026 {
7027 struct cfs_rq *cfs_rq = &rq->cfs;
7028 struct sched_entity *se;
7029 struct task_struct *p;
7030 int new_tasks;
7031
7032 if (prev &&
7033 fair_policy(prev->policy) &&
> 7034 sched_idle_cpu(rq->cpu))
7035 goto idle;
7036
7037 again:
7038 if (!sched_fair_runnable(rq))
7039 goto idle;
7040
